Associate Director / Technical Director - Town Planning
Location: Sheffield (hybrid working available)
Type: Permanent | Full-time
Salary: Competitive + car allowance + bonus + excellent benefits

An internationally recognised consultancy is looking to appoint a senior-level Associate Director or Technical Director in Sheffield to lead and grow its regional Town Planning team. This role offers a unique opportunity to take the lead on nationally significant infrastructure and development projects across the UK, while shaping the growth of the planning function in the North.

You''ll be part of a well-established, multi-disciplinary environment team, collaborating with experts across transport, energy, environment, and engineering on some of the UK''s most critical and innovative schemes.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ead and grow the Sheffield-based planning team, working closely with colleagues across the North.

  • Deliver expert planning services on large-scale infrastructure, housing, and development projects.

  • Manage bids, client relationships, and multi-disciplinary delivery.

  • Contribute to thought leadership and service innovation in planning, with a focus on Net Zero, ESG, and digital planning tools.

  • Develop new business opportunities and help shape long-term strategy in the region.

About You

  • RTPI Chartered Planner with an RTPI-accredited qualification.

  • Proven consultancy experience with leadership capability.

  • Strong understanding of planning law, project delivery and commercial management.

  • Track record of delivering complex infrastructure or development schemes.

  • Excellent client engagement, communication and team-building skills.

  • A collaborative mindset and interest in shaping future planning solutions.

What''s on Offer

  • Work on flagship projects including HS2, offshore wind, hydrogen energy, and housing for Homes England.

  • Be part of a company regularly recognised as a top UK employer, committed to equity, diversity and inclusion.

  • Hybrid working, flexible arrangements and long-term career progression.

  • Competitive salary, car allowance, bonus and industry-leading benefits package.
